Flickering Myth’s Greatest Comic Book Movies: #11 – Scott Pilgrim vs. the World (2010)

April 15, 2013 by admin

Throughout April, we’re counting down to the release of Marvel’s Iron Man 3 with our picks for the Greatest Comic Book Movies of All Time; here’s #11…

Scott Pilgrim vs. the World, 2010.

Directed by Edgar Wright.
Starring Michael Cera, Mary Elizabeth Winstead, Kieran Culkin, Chris Evans, Anna Kendrick, Alison Pill, Brandon Routh and Jason Schwartzman.

Based on the Scott Pilgrim graphic novel series by cartoonist Brian Lee O’Malley, Scott Pilgrim vs. the World stars Michael Cera as a young musician who meets the girl of his dreams, Ramona Flowers (Mary Elizabeth Winstead), but in order to win her heart he has to do battle with ‘The League of Evil Exes’ – including a former Superman in Brandon Routh and the current Captain America in Chris Evans.

Despite being well received by critics, Scott Pilgrim vs. the World struggled to connect with audiences upon its theatrical release and ultimately went out with a whimper at the box office, earning just $47 million on a budget of $60 million. However, there was plenty love for British filmmaker Edgar Wright’s Hollywood debut in our voting – so much so that the comedy just missed out on a place in our top ten by the narrowest of margins.

Edgar Wright will soon join Chris Evans as part of the Marvel Cinematic Universe, with the director finally set to bring his long-in-development Ant-Man adaptation to the screen by kicking off Phase Three of the MCU on November 6th 2015 – at which point Evans will have reprised the role of Steve Rogers for two further Marvel adventures in Captain America: The Winter Soldier and The Avengers 2.
